summaryrefslogtreecommitdiff
path: root/gcc/common
diff options
context:
space:
mode:
authorKito Cheng <kito.cheng@sifive.com>2020-11-06 11:05:50 +0800
committerKito Cheng <kito.cheng@sifive.com>2020-11-06 11:20:20 +0800
commit56ecdc2f02bfa69021003d7ac267dc65f385902f (patch)
tree188afc17a527eb1865e46be8356402e45c59f77d /gcc/common
parent65e82636bcdb72a878c2e53943e71b15dd9fb22d (diff)
downloadgcc-56ecdc2f02bfa69021003d7ac267dc65f385902f.tar.gz
RISC-V: Mark non-export symbol static and const in riscv-common.c
gcc/ChangeLog: * common/config/riscv/riscv-common.c (riscv_implied_info): Add static and const. (riscv_subset_list::handle_implied_ext): Add const due to riscv_implied_info changed to const.
Diffstat (limited to 'gcc/common')
-rw-r--r--gcc/common/config/riscv/riscv-common.c4
1 files changed, 2 insertions, 2 deletions
diff --git a/gcc/common/config/riscv/riscv-common.c b/gcc/common/config/riscv/riscv-common.c
index 84695a6ed1b..9a576eb689b 100644
--- a/gcc/common/config/riscv/riscv-common.c
+++ b/gcc/common/config/riscv/riscv-common.c
@@ -54,7 +54,7 @@ struct riscv_implied_info_t
};
/* Implied ISA info, must end with NULL sentinel. */
-riscv_implied_info_t riscv_implied_info[] =
+static const riscv_implied_info_t riscv_implied_info[] =
{
{"d", "f"},
{NULL, NULL}
@@ -459,7 +459,7 @@ riscv_subset_list::handle_implied_ext (const char *ext,
int minor_version,
bool explicit_version_p)
{
- riscv_implied_info_t *implied_info;
+ const riscv_implied_info_t *implied_info;
for (implied_info = &riscv_implied_info[0];
implied_info->ext;
++implied_info)